Manages and extends NanoClaw v2, a zero-dependency, session-aware REPL for persistent and branched AI interactions.
NanoClaw REPL is a specialized skill designed to operate and extend the NanoClaw v2 environment, a lightweight interaction loop built on Claude. It provides advanced session management capabilities, including markdown-backed persistence, history compaction to optimize token usage, and session branching for risk-free experimentation. This skill is ideal for developers who require a local, extensible, and deterministic way to interact with Claude while maintaining full control over their interaction history and model selection.
